Domestic tourism is expected to remain a major driver of growth for South Africa's (SA) tourism sector as Africa's Travel Indaba 2026 concludes in the city of Durba, in KwaZulu Natal province.
Industry stakeholders say initiatives aimed at encouraging local travel are becoming increasingly important amid global economic pressures and changing consumer spending patterns.
